May 25, 2023 · Ad fraud is a broad term encompassing the practice of viewing, clicking, converting, or generating false interactions with any web asset for the sole purpose of earning money directly or indirectly. It can be perpetrated in any number of ways: by malware, bots, humans behind keyboards, or any combination. The Cost of Ad Fraud. Numerous studies show that ad fraud costs the digital advertising industry between US $26 billion and US $42 billion a year. To put that into perspective, global digital ad spend in 2019 was estimated to be US $333.25 billion . There are two types of invalid traffic, namely General Invalid Traffic (GIVT) and Sophisticated Invalid Traffic (SIVT). These invalid traffic cripples advertising budgets, which makes ad spend optimization a challenge almost every brand faces.

Hidden ads are those that are displayed so that the user does not see them. This type of ad fraud targets ad networks that pay based on impressions and views, not clicks. 2. Click hijacking. In click hijacking, an “steals” a click by directing the user to a different link or ad than the one he was trying to go to. It’s estimated that there will be a $100 bln loss in digital ad spending by 2023 due to ad fraud. Source: Statista. Types of Ad Fraud 1. Pixel Stuffing. Pixel stuffing means that more than one ad is placed into one single 1×1 pixel area.
